Monona committee amends 2025 budget to maintain full‑time administrative position

The committee approved a budget amendment on Aug. 4 to restore a full‑time deputy clerk/administrative support position by reallocating funds from judicial/legal and other accounts; officials said the change aims to improve front‑counter service and internal redundancy with minimal levy impact.

The Committee of the City of Monona on Aug. 4 approved Resolution 25-8-2820 to amend the 2025 operating budget and maintain a full‑time administrative/deputy clerk position in the administration department. City staff said the change converts an unfilled part‑time court clerk position back into a full‑time administrative support role to cover counter service, phones, and technical backup for accounts payable and payroll.
